In reality, learn what to expect from the get go.

Everyone is not meant to be your friend.

Your social world is meant to have TIERS.
The tiers include:

Friends

Acquaintances

Strangers
When you forget there are tiers, you consider everyone a friend.

The goal is to have a small number of high quality friends.

And a high quantity of acquaintances
Friends are the people you can count on when shit hits the fan.

The feeling needs to be mutual

Otherwise you need to push that person to an acquaintance
Acquaintances are meant to be plentiful.

The beauty about them is they're often lower maintenance

You can just hit them up once a month to see how everything is going

And that's good in many cases
Acquaintances give your social circle a larger presence

Bc they know ppl you had no clue existed before

And they can convert those strangers into new acquaintances for ya
This is why for an immediate squad, you want to keep it small

Small & full of loyal ones
